Output edb151ad63ffb587bc08ce52d5b42e568ab225650dd18bc01bbe46b4e1c299d4:0

value
6097560976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15d81f31de96e12019cfab170cbb0e294e5a0dbe OP_EQUALVERIFY OP_CHECKSIG
address
D78bdhMcJCcDYdAVmBvVHcnS9stGEz7yQy
transaction
edb151ad63ffb587bc08ce52d5b42e568ab225650dd18bc01bbe46b4e1c299d4